Inđija is a town and a municipality located in the Srem District of the autonomous province of Vojvodina, Serbia. As of 2024, the town has total population of 28,450, while the municipality has 47,433 inhabitants. It is located in the geographical region of Syrmia.

The Srem District is one of seven administrative districts of the autonomous province of Vojvodina, Serbia. It lies in the geographical regions of Syrmia and Mačva. According to the 2022 census results, it has a population of 282,547 inhabitants. The administrative center is the city of Sremska Mitrovica.
